Tinubu's foreign trips most productive - Shehu Sani says, cites $4.2bn Brazil grant

Former Kaduna Central Senator Shehu Sani stated that Bola Tinubu has been the most productive president in terms of foreign trips.

In a post on his social media page, Sani noted that President Tinubu's foreign trips since taking office in 2023 have resulted in significant economic gains for Nigeria. This, he claimed, is a departure from the wasteful foreign trips of previous presidents.

Sani specifically highlighted the economic benefits of President Tinubu's visits to Saudi Arabia, Brazil, France, China, and South Africa. He expressed excitement over Brazil's $4.2 billion grant to boost Nigeria's agriculture, which will be distributed among local governments.

“The history of Presidential foreign travels in this country has been infamously known to be wasteful. However, there is an evidently notable difference this time around,” Sani wrote on his X handle. “The President’s visit to Saudi, Brazil, France, China, and South Africa attracted verifiable and practical economic gains for Nigeria.”

“To travel and come back with something huge is ok; to travel and come back with nothing is not ok,” Sani added

Sani’s comments come as Nigeria’s foreign direct investment (FDI) increased by 248.1% ($103.82m) in Q3 2024, according to the latest economic statistics.
